当前位置:首页 » 操作系统 » ice数据库

ice数据库

发布时间: 2022-04-17 23:38:46

sql Server中常见的问题与解决方法

关于事务日志

在使用sql server时,经常会出现系统提示事务日志
已满的错误信息(错误1105),以使的应用系统的数据库
无法打开,影响到系统的正常运行。通常有三种方法可以
解决这一问题:

●扩展数据库空间

可以通过扩展数据库大小来增大事务日志的空间。先
利用alter database增大数据库空间,再通过sp—logdev
ice系统存储过程把事务日志转移到事务日志数据库设备
上去,具体语法如下:

语法:

·alter database database—name on database—d
evice’增大数据库空间

·sp—logdevice dbname,database_device’转移
事务日志

例:alterdatabasemydbonmydb—log—dev=8

sp—logdevicemydbmydb—log—dev

如果数据库对数据库设备变得过大(通常在决定数据
库大小时,先指定一个保守的值,如果以后需要增大空间
,用alter database增加其大小),需先扩展数据库设备
,再增大事务日志的空间,具体语法如下:

语法:

·disk resize name=logical—device_name,size=
final—size’扩展数据库设备

·alter database database—name on database—d
evice’增大数据库空间

·sp_logdevicedbname,database_device’转移事
务日志

例:disk resize name=mydb on mydb—log—dev=8

alter database mydb on mydb—log—dev=8

sp—logdevice mydb mydb—log—dev

(以上工作也可以通过对microsoft sql enterprise
manger提供的gui界面直接操作来完成。)

●定期执行mp database语句来完成截短
事务日志。其语法为:

语法:

·mp database dbname to mp_device

例:mp databas emydb to mymp—dev(通过将
数据库mydb备份到备份设备mymp—dev上完成截短事务日
志。)

●trunc.logonchkpt.选项来完成截短事
务日志

缺省时,在新建的数据库上,trunc.logonchkpt.
选项设置成off(缺省值),事务日志永远不作备份,事务
日志不停地增长,可能会耗尽数据库的存储空间,将trun
c.logonchkpt.选项设置成on,每次checkpoint进程发
生时(通常每分钟一次)都截短事务日志(删除已提交的
事务),使得事务日志不会不停地增长以耗尽数据库的存
储空间。

配置选项和值

在使用sql server时,同样会经常出现系统提示user
connections(用户连接)已达到配置数,系统无法正常
运行的问题。sql server用户连接最大值是32767,而缺
省时的一般配置数为15个。如果使用中的用户连接已达到
配置数,而又来了一个用户连接请求,sqlserver将回送一
个错误消息。这时可以通过修改sql server的配置选项中
的user connections项的最大值来解决这一问题。配置选
项的显示和管理可通过sp—configure系统过程来完成,
但不能使用sp—configure来设定一个比当前配置选项最大
值还大的配置选项。

语法:sp—configure〔‘config—name’〔,confi
g—value〕〕

其中config—name为配置选项的项名,config—valu
e为设置值。

例:sp—configure‘user_connections’,30

同时用户可以使用sp—configure来显示配置选项,
通过重新设置一些配置选项,调节性能和优化存储分配。
(注:修改sql server的配置选项,必须以系统管理员身
份登录。)?

❷ ice3.5.1 vs2010环境配置

您好,
1、安装VS2010,安装WDK 7.0(DDK);
2、新建VC++->空项目

3、打开(生成-->配置管理器) 并新建一个名称为"Dirver"的解决方案配置 从此处复制设置:debug

并将"Dirver" 设为活动解决方案配置。

4、打开 视图 -> 属性管理器。

5、在"Dirver" 解决方案配置 上点击右键,选择 添加新项目属性表 取名为"dirverProperty" 并对他进行以下设置。

5.1
C\C++ 常规 调试信息格式 = 程序数据库(/ZI)
5.2 C\C++ 预处理器 - 预处理器定义 = _X86_

_WIN32_WINNT=0x0500
5.3 C\C++ 代码生成 - 启用 C++ 异常 = 否

5.4 C\C++ 代码生成 - 基本运行时检查 = 默认

5.5 C\C++ 代码生成 - 缓冲区安全检查 = 否(/GS-)

5.6 C\C++ 高级 - 调用约定 = __stdcall(/Gz)

5.7 C\C++ 高级 - 编译为 = 编译为C代码(/Tz)

5.8 链接器 - 常规 - 输出文件 = $(OutDir)\$(ProjectName).sys

5.9 链接器 - 常规 - 启用增量链接 = 默认

5.10 链接器 - 输入 - 附加依赖项 =

*
ntoskrnl.lib
hal.lib
wdm.lib
wdmsec.lib
wmilib.lib
ndis.lib
MSVCRT.LIB
LIBCMT.LIB
5.11 链接器 - 输入 - 忽略所有默认库 = 是(/NODEFAULTLIB)

5.12 链接器 - 清单文件 - 生成清单 = 否(/MANIFEST:NO)

5.13 链接器 - 系统 - 子系统 = 本机(/SUBSYSTEM:NATIVE)

5.14 链接器 - 系统 - 驱动程序 = 驱动程序(/Driver)

5.15 链接器 - 高级 - 入口点 = DriverEntry

5.16 链接器 - 高级 - 基址 = 0x10000

5.17 链接器 - 高级 - 随机基址 = 置空 *

5.18 链接器 - 高级 - 数据执行保护 = 置空 *

5.19 通用属性-常规 - 目标文件扩展名 =.sys

6、配置vc++目录

6.1 视图 - 属性管理器

展开 Dirver -> 找到 Microsoft.Cpp.Win32.user 右键 -> 属性

打开 VC++ 目录

包含目录

=
D:\WinDDK\7600.16385.1\inc
D:\WinDDK\7600.16385.1\inc\ddk
D:\WinDDK\7600.16385.1\inc\api
库目录 =

D:\WinDDK\7600.16385.1\lib\wnet\i386

❸ 求帮忙下载论文在英国土木工程协会数据库( ICE),学校没有购买该数据库。

Ice 是一种面向对象的中间件平台。从根本上说,这意味着Ice 为构建面向对象的客户-服务
器应用提供了工具、API 和库支持。Ice 应用适合在异种环境中使用:客户和服务器可以用不
同的编程语言编写,可以运行在不同的操作系统和机器架构上,并且可以使用多种网络技术
进行通信。无论部署环境如何,这些应用的源码都是可移植的。

❹ iceworks用的什么数据库

mysql数据库数据库mysql(免费的,简单),现在很多公司都用这个.oracle(收费的),安全性较高.

❺ ICE的简介

前面我们提到过在设计网站架构的时候可以使用ICE实现对网站应用的基础对象操作,将基础 对象操作和数据库操作封装在这一层,在业务逻辑层以及表现层(java,php,.net,python)进行更丰富的表现与操作,从而实现比较好的架 构。基于ICE的数据层可以在未来方便的进行扩展。ICE支持分布式的部署管理,消息中间件,以及网格计算等等。
Zeroc推出的一种分布式的面向对象中间件,解决分布式的异构计算。可以用C++,Java,c#等进行分布式的交互计算。

❻ 如何在mimic数据库中搜索ice code

登录并搜索。
MIMIC数据库是MIT麻省理工下属管理的一个公共临床数据库,全称,直译过来就是重症监护医学信息集市。到现在为止MIMIC数据库已更新至MIMIC-IIIv1.4版。

❼ mysql数据库卸载后重装报错误could not start the serveice mysql。配置时候就出错

这个是由于你卸载之前的程序的时候,未完全删除之前的文件导致的。不是注册表,一般的是 系统目录下的 mysq/data 你可以全盘搜索,找出来删除了。然后再装。

❽ ice中间件可以通过防火墙连接数据库吗

首先,下载Ice-3.4.2.msi,下一步下一步安装。
安装完成后到C:\ProgramData\ZeroC 下面有两个props文件,其中的XML标记是错误的,需要修改一下,否则打不开DEMO工程。测试DEMO的时候必须把C:\Program Files\ZeroC\Ice-3.4.2\bin\vc100添加到环境变量中,否则不能运行DEMO.
如果是新建ICE工程,还要在vs工程右键--》ICE cinfiguration设置enable ice builder。这是一个插件。

❾ oalce数据库介绍

编辑本段一、概论ORACLE 数据库系统是美国ORACLE公司(甲骨文)提供的以分布式数据库为核心的一组软件产品,是目前最流行的客户/服务器(CLIENT/SERVER)或B/S体系结构的数据库之一。比如SilverStream就是基于数据库的一种中间件。ORACLE数据库是目前世界上使用最为广泛的数据库管理系统,作为一个通用的数据库系统,它具有完整的数据管理功能;作为一个关系数据库,它是一个完备关系的产品;作为分布式数据库它实现了分布式处理功能。但它的所有知识,只要在一种机型上学习了ORACLE知识,便能在各种类型的机器上使用它。
编辑本段二、特点1、完整的数据管理功能:
1)数据的大量性
2)数据的保存的持久性
3)数据的共享性
4)数据的可靠性
2、完备关系的产品:
1)信息准则---关系型DBMS的所有信息都应在逻辑上用一种方法,即表中的值显式地表示;
2)保证访问的准则
3)视图更新准则---只要形成视图的表中的数据变化了,相应的视图中的数据同时变化
4)数据物理性和逻辑性独立准则
3、分布式处理功能:
1)ORACLE数据库自第5版起就提供了分布式处理能力,到第7版就有比较完善的分布式数据库功能了,一个ORACLE分布式数据库由oracle rdbms、sql*Net、SQL*CONNECT和其他非ORACLE的关系型产品构成。我相信现在我们用到的基本上是8i或9i的产品了。
4、用ORACLE能轻松的实现数据仓库的操作。
这是一个技术发展的趋势,不在这里讨论。
编辑本段三、ORALCE和Sybase SQL Server的比较:在了解了ORACLE数据库后,我们有必要对ORALCE和Sybase SQL Server的比较, Oracle采用的是并行服务器模式,而Sybase SQL Server采用的是虚拟服务器模式,它没有将一个查询分解成多个子查询,再在不同的CPU上同时执行这些子查询。我们可以说在对称多处理方面Oracle的性能优于Sybase的性能。业务量往往在系统运行后不断提高,如果数据库数量达到GB以上时,我们在提高系统的性能方面可以从两方面入手,一种是提高单台服务器的性能,还有就是增加服务器数目。基于此,如果我们是提高单台服务器的性能,选择Oracle 数据库较好,因为它们能在对称多CPU的系统上提供并行处理。相反,由于Sybase的导航服务器使网上的所有用户都注册到导航服务器并通过导航服务提出数据访问请求,导航服务器则将用户的请求分解,然后自动导向由它所控制的多台SQL Server,从而在分散数据的基础上提供并行处理能力,我们可以选择它。这些都是在其他条件和环境相同的情况下比较的,这样才有可比性。在数据的分布更新方面,Oracle采用的是基于服务器的自动的2PC(两阶段提交),而Sybase采用的则是基于客户机DB-Library或CT-Library的可编程的2PC,因此我们在选择数据库方面,必须根据需要进行选择,比如,我现在从事的社会保险软件的开发,考虑到数据量大,并发操作比较多,实时性要求高,我们后台基本采取的是ORACLE数据库。

❿ icewarp+server怎么进行环境配置

PHP开发调试环境配置(基于wampserver+Eclipse for PHP Developers )
因为项目需求,需要开发PHP的项目,所以不得不花点时间开始学习PHP,过程非常要抓狂,还没有开始开发已经被一大堆复杂的环境搭建搞疯了

经过多方实验,决定将过程记录下来,也为了让很多跟我一样从零开始学习PHP的朋友少走弯路,当然如果在各个组件之间的关系有什么疑问,也可以单独私聊我

1 软件准

WampServer

下载地址:http://www.wampserver.com/en/#download-wrapper
我下的是 里面包含了搭建PHP必须的4个软件:
1. Apache 2.2.21
2. Php 5.3.10
3. Mysql 5.5.20
4. XDebug 2.1.2
提示:为什么要使用WampServer呢? 因为如果单独安装这些软件,首先是一个个安装很麻烦;其次是每个软件都要进行配置;第三是你安装的各软件之间可能版本并不相互匹配;最后由于版本不一致,可能配置的时候也会有细微的差别。而采用WampServer就好多了,它包含了搭建PHP开发调试环境的全部软件(包括Xdebug),而且需配置的地方非常的少,当然还不需要你考虑版本之间的匹配问题。

Eclipse for PHP Developers

下载地址:http://www.eclipse.org/downloads/packages/eclipse-php-developers/heliossr1

JDK安装(eclipse本身运行的前提就是JDK正确安装)

下载地址: http://www.java.net/download/jdk7u60/archive/b11/binaries/jdk-7u60-ea-bin-b11-windows-x64-19_mar_2014.exe

JDK下载要注意版本,比如Eclipse是64位的,则jdk也要安装64位的

安装过程,我就不说了,下面直接讲配置

一 : JDK配置

1. 右击:我的电脑——〉属性——〉高级——〉环境变量

2. 在系统变量里面找到“Path”这一项,然后双击它,在弹出的界面上,在变量值开头添加如下语句

D:/common/Java/jdk1.6.0_02/bin;

注意不要忘了后面的分号,然后点击编辑系统变量界面的确定按钮

3. 点击环境变量界面的“新建”,

变量名为:JAVA_HOME

变量值为:D:/common/Java/jdk1.6.0_02;

注意分号,然后点击新建系统变量界面的确定按钮

4. 点击环境变量界面的“新建”,弹出新建系统变量界面,

变量名为:classpath , 变量值为:.;

注意是点和分号,然后一路点击确定按钮,到此设置就完成了。

第四步:检测安装配置是否成功

进行完上面的步骤,基本的安装和配置就好了,怎么知道安装成功没有呢?

点击:开始——〉运行,在弹出的对话框中输入“cmd”,然后点击确定,在弹出的 dos 窗口里面,

输入“javac”,然后回车,出现 javac 的列表则表示安装配置成功。

这边正常之后,如果打开eclips任然报错,可能是jdk版本和eclips版本不一致(bit32和bit64)

二:WampServer 配置

第一步:Apache的配置

通常程序员,电脑上的80的端口都会被占用,所以这里修改端口80为8088端口:
(1)左键托盘图标,在Apache里可以直接打开httpd.conf,查找到Listen 80,可以改成其他端口,我选用8088。
(2)重启wamp,就可以生效了。但是Localhost、phpMyAdmin、SQLiteManager,你可以点击打开看到依旧是默认的80端口。找到wamp安装目录下的wampmanager.tpl文件,记事本打开:在http://localhost后面添加8088端口,保存,退出并重新打开wamp生效。(其实,wampmanager.ini文件中的类似的URL地址也随之更改了)

修改www目录:

(1)需要修改Apache的httpd.conf文件,有2处修改: 搜索类似 DocumentRoot "d:/wamp/www/"和<Directory "d:/wamp/www/">
修改为 DocumentRoot "e:/dev/web/"和<Directory "e:/dev/web/">
(2)wampmanager.tpl文件,修改如下:FileName: "${wwwDir}"为FileName: "e:/dev/web"
(3)wampmanager.ini文件,修改如下:[Menu.Left] 下FileName: "d:/wamp/www" 修改为FileName: "e:/dev/web"

注意:这里修改了路径之后,会报错:Unable to open WampServer's config file, please change path in index.php file

解决方法:打开新路径中的index.php,修改$wampConfFile = 'D:/WampServer/wampmanager.conf';(实际路径)

Xdebug的配置
网上很多资料都要手动下载Xdebug并且自行配置,然而这个版本的WampServer里面已经包含了Xdebug(位于C:\wamp\bin\php\php5.3.8\zend_ext下),并且自动配置过了。所以我们基本不需要配置什么,唯一需要配的就是打开C:\wamp\bin\apache\Apache2.2.21\bin下的php.ini,找到最后几行中的xdebug.remote_enable = off,改成xdebug.remote_enable = on。这样做是为了在eclipse中调试时可以进入断点。

修改MYSQL数据库密码

wampserver默认安装的数据库是没有对应的访问密码的,这里我们需要设置以下密码

1、左键点击,选择“phpMyAdmin”,就会打开phpMyAdmin的管理页面,点击右上方的“权限”,一般情况下会出现如图所示的表格,我们要做的就是点击每一行用户名为root的右边的。

2、点击后,找到如图二所示的修改密码区域,填入欲修改的密码,再点击右下方的执行,片刻之后上方就会出现修改成功的提示,每一个root用户均需要做此操作,如果一时半会想不到一个好的密码,也可以使用“生成密码”功能生成一个随机的密码,但是这个密码一定要记住,忘记了麻烦可就大了。
备注:修改密码后可以看到 对应账户 密码栏 由原来的“否”变为“是”,如上图 绿色圈出部分。那么添加新用户(接下来会详细讲到)、删除用户 如 上图红色标出部分即可完成操作!

3、做完上述操作之后重启一下MySQL服务,然后刷新页面,大家就会发现出现了如图所示的错误,这是为什么呢
是因为刚才我们修改了MySQL的密码,但是没有修改phpMyAdmin与MySQL通讯的密码,怎么改呢?打开wampserver安装目录,然后依次打开\wamp\apps\phpmyadmin3.3.9,用记事本或者DW软件打开里面的config.inc.php,找到“$cfg['Servers'][$i]['password'] = '';”,在最后的两个单引号里面输入刚才修改的那个密码,然后保存,操作完毕之后再刷新一下phpMyAdmin的页面,是不是恢复正常了呢?

Eclipse配置

一:配置workspace

打开Eclipse for PHP Developers,需要设置workspace,这个必须设置到wamp的www目录,否则待会无法进行调试。我的www目录是C:\wamp\www
配置调试环境
进入Eclipse -- Window – Preferences 设置 PHP Executable。里需要注意PHP.INI的路径,这里的路径是WAMP SERVER中特有的放在了apache目录下

设置PHP-->debug,选择XDebug

二:配置PHP Server

热点内容
随机字符串php 发布:2024-11-15 14:03:46 浏览:122
怎样用数据库搭建服务器 发布:2024-11-15 13:58:39 浏览:478
android编码设置 发布:2024-11-15 13:50:02 浏览:907
androidstringchar 发布:2024-11-15 13:45:00 浏览:965
obs配置怎么弄 发布:2024-11-15 13:43:30 浏览:868
特斯拉买哪个配置的 发布:2024-11-15 13:42:36 浏览:557
儿童编程教材 发布:2024-11-15 13:37:34 浏览:43
查询服务器连接地址 发布:2024-11-15 13:27:20 浏览:505
win8用户文件夹转移 发布:2024-11-15 13:21:24 浏览:74
批量缓存淘宝教育上的视频 发布:2024-11-15 13:20:44 浏览:724